What does the SQLERRM Function do? The SQLERRM function returns the error message associated with the most recently raised error exception. This function should only be used within the Exception Handling section of your code. Syntax The syntax for the SQLERRM function in Oracle/PLSQL is: SQLERRM https://www.techonthenet.com/oracle/exceptions/sqlerrm.php Parameters or Arguments There are no parameters or arguments for the SQLERRM function. Note See also the SQLCODE function. The Oracle docs note this on the ora-06508 error: ORA-06508: PL/SQL: could not find program unit being called. Cause: An attempt was made to oracle sql call a stored program that could not be found. The program may have been dropped or incompatibly modified, or have compiled with errors. Action: Check that all referenced programs, including their package bodies, exist and are compatible. In Oracle warehouse builder (OWB) and other PL/SQL operations, you get the ORA-06508 error when one of the program units has not find ora error been properly compiled or it cannot be located (a problem with your $PATH environment variable). An attempt was made to call a stored program that could not be found. The program may have been dropped or incompatibly modified, or have compiled with errors. Check that all referenced programs, including their package bodies, exist and are compatible. You can use this script to recompile any invalid objects. ORA-00257: archiver error tips Oracle Error Tips by Burleson Consulting Question: I am running Oracle Apps and getting a ORA-00257 error: ORA-00257: archiver error. Connect internal only, until freed. Answer: The oerr utility says this about the ORA-00257 error: ORA-00257: archiver error. Connect internal only, until freed.Cause: The archiver process received an error while trying to archive a redo log. If the problem is not resolved soon, the database will stop executing transactions. The most likely cause of this message is the destination device is out of space to store the redo log file.Action: Check the archiver trace file for a detailed description of the problem. Also, verify that the device specified in the initialization parameter archive_log_dest is set up properly for archiving. The Oracle ARCH background process is responsible for taking the redo logs from the online redo log file system and writing them to the flat file Also see ADRCI cannot create archive log file in Oracle Applications. ORA-00257 is a common error in Oracle. You will usually see ORA-00257 upon connecting to the database because you have encountered a maximum in the flash recovery area (FRA), or db_recovery_file_dest_size .
